1 2 3 4 5 6 7 U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T WESTERN DISTRICT OF WASHINGTON AT SEATTLE 8 9 KISCHE USA LLC, 10 11 12 CASE NO. C16-0168JLR Plaintiff, MINUTE ORDER v. ALI SIMSEK, et al., 13 Defendants. 14 15 16 17 The following minute order is made by the direction of the court, the Honorable James L. Robart: The court orders Plaintiff Kische USA LLC (“Kische”) to file a copy of its 18 proposed second amended complaint that complies with the formatting instructions 19 described in Local Civil Rule 15. See Local Rules W.D. Wash. LCR 15; (Mot. to Amend 20 (Dkt. # 66).) Although Kische filed its proposed amended complaint as an exhibit to its 21 pending motion for leave to amend (see Local Rules W.D. Wash. LCR 15), Kische did 22 not indicate how its proposed second amended complaint “differs from the pleading that MINUTE ORDER - 1 1 it amends by bracketing or striking through the text to be deleted and underlining or 2 highlighting the text to be added.,” id. Kische must file a proposed second amended 3 complaint that complies with Local Civil Rule 15 no later than February 7, 2017, at 12:00 4 p.m. Failure to do so may result in the court denying Kische’s pending motion for leave 5 to amend its complaint. (See Mot. to Amend.) 6 Filed and entered this 3rd day of February, 2017. 7 WILLIAM M.
